In an experiment to measure the acceleration due to gravity, g two values, 9.96 m/s2 and 9.72 m/s2 , are determined. Find
(1) the percent difference of the measurements,
(2) the percent error of each measurement, and
(3) the percent error of their mean. (Accepted value: g = 9.80 m/s2 .)
